Beyond Individual Brilliance: The Power of Teamwork in Marketing
The marketing landscape demands a multifaceted approach. Here’s why building a strong marketing team is crucial:
- A Spectrum of Expertise: Marketing encompasses various specialized areas. From content creators and graphic designers to social media specialists and data analysts, a diverse team brings a wider range of skills and knowledge to the table.
- Enhanced Creativity and Innovation: Collaboration fosters a breeding ground for creative ideas. By bouncing ideas off each other, team members can develop more innovative marketing campaigns and content strategies.
- Improved Efficiency and Productivity: Dividing tasks and leveraging individual strengths allows for a more efficient workflow. Teamwork helps ensure deadlines are met and projects are completed to a high standard.
- Enhanced Problem-Solving: Complex marketing challenges often require multifaceted solutions. A team can approach problems from different perspectives, leading to more effective and creative solutions.
- Boosted Employee Morale and Motivation: Working towards a common goal as a team fosters a sense of camaraderie and shared purpose. This can lead to higher employee morale, motivation, and overall job satisfaction.
The Art of Team Leadership: Strategies for Effective Collaboration
Building a high-performing marketing team requires strong leadership skills. Here are some key strategies to consider:
- Clearly Defined Roles and Responsibilities: Each team member needs to understand their roles, responsibilities, and how their individual contribution fits into the overall marketing strategy.
- Open Communication and Transparency: Creating an environment where open communication is encouraged fosters trust and collaboration. Regular team meetings, brainstorming sessions, and information sharing are crucial.
- Empowerment and Ownership: Empowering team members to own their tasks and make decisions fosters a sense of responsibility and ownership. This can lead to increased motivation and engagement.
- Creating a Culture of Feedback and Recognition: Providing constructive feedback helps team members improve their skills. Recognizing and celebrating achievements boosts morale and motivates teams to strive for excellence.
- Fostering Diversity and Inclusion: A diverse team brings a broader range of perspectives to the table. Marketing managers should actively promote diversity and inclusion within their teams.
